Salma Shawa
About Salma Shawa
Salma Shawa is a Senior Human Resources Specialist focused on Training and Career Development at Consolidated Contractors International Company in Athens, Greece, where she has worked since 2013. She holds a Doctor of Philosophy from the London School of Economics and has a diverse educational background including degrees from the American University in Cairo and Parsons School of Design.
